The Molins de Rei Horror Film Festival, the Department of Culture of the City Council of Molins de Rei and the El Molí Library of Molins de Rei, have announced the 16th edition of the Horror Microstory Competition. This edition received 418 micro-stories, from both Catalan and Spanish areas and from abroad. The verdict of the 16th edition of the Horror Microstory Competition has been the following:

Best Microstory in Catalan: The slaughterhouse, by Lluís Planellas Giné (Barcelona).

The guard pulls my bridle to let me into the room. I obey like a beggar so he doesn't get angry (he has a long hand). I quickly regret it. This looks like a chamber of horrors. There are blood stains on the walls and a disgusting puddle of who knows what is dripping down the sink. A woman and a boy dressed in white are checking an arsenal of torture instruments arranged along a metal table. This must be a mistake, I tell myself. I've been good. I haven't even complained about the food. I even gave them my son. Why should they punish me? "Prepare the electrodes," the woman says to the boy. "First, you stun her; then you slit her throat, gut her, and flay her. Understand?" "Understand. What?! Mercy! I'll tell you everything I know!" Do you want names? I'll say names! But please don't kill me! I'm innocent! I swear! —What a talkative sheep — the boy says, stroking the back of my neck. —Stop talking nonsense and stun her. She's nothing but an animal. Monsters! Murderers! Sons of…! BOOM!

*Special mention Best Microstory in Catalan: Family Christmas, by Jordi Places Rabal (Molins de Rei).

Family, what a great time we had this Christmas! It was definitely unforgettable and I hope the next one is just as good or even better! She took her husband's head and her son's head and put them back in her freezer until next year.

Best Microstory in Spanish: Eternity, by Almudena Gutiérrez Gómez (Cartagena).

I had a horrible nightmare last night. I dreamed that I was locked in a very small place, where there was no light. I screamed and screamed, but no one heard me. I woke up with a start, and hit my head with the lid of the coffin.

*Special mention Best Microstory in Spanish: The cup, by Alejandro Gomis Arnal (Bétera, Valencia).

When I got halfway through the glass, I realized that the bartender wasn't serving me wine.

Special “Instituts” Award for Best Microstory (for students of educational centers): The psychiatrist, by Lucas Santos Vizuete (Molins de Rei).

-I hate this psychiatric hospital, I've been here rotting and wasting away for years, I detest the doctors and nurses, with their hypocritical smiles and their poorly disguised flirtations, I want to stain the walls of this place with their blood! I'll desert them, one of these days, one of these days I will!- -Doctor... what you're saying is very sinister- the patient replied.
